Creating a Foundry resource unlocks access to models, agents, and tools through a unified set of SDKs and endpoints. This article covers what each SDK is for and which endpoint to use.
| SDK | What it's for | Endpoint |
|---|---|---|
| Foundry SDK | Foundry-specific capabilities with OpenAI-compatible interfaces. Includes access to Foundry direct models through the Responses API (not Chat Completions). | https://<resource-name>.services.ai.azure.com/api/projects/<project-name> |
| OpenAI SDK | Latest OpenAI SDK models and features with the full OpenAI API surface. Foundry direct models available through Chat Completions API (not Responses). | https://<resource-name>.openai.azure.com/openai/v1 |
| Foundry Tools SDKs | Prebuilt solutions (Vision, Speech, Content Safety, and more). | Tool-specific endpoints (varies by service). |
| Agent Framework | Multi-agent orchestration in code. Cloud-agnostic. | Uses the project endpoint via the Foundry SDK. |
Note
Resource types: A Foundry resource provides all endpoints previously listed. An Azure OpenAI resource provides only the /openai/v1 endpoint.
Authentication: Samples here use Microsoft Entra ID (DefaultAzureCredential). API keys work on /openai/v1. Pass the key as api_key instead of a token provider.

Using the Foundry SDK
The SDK exposes two client types because Foundry and OpenAI have different API shapes:
- Project client – Use for Foundry-native operations where OpenAI has no equivalent. Examples: listing connections, retrieving project properties, enabling tracing.
- OpenAI-compatible client – Use for Foundry functionality that builds on OpenAI concepts. The Responses API, agents, evaluations, and fine-tuning all use OpenAI-style request/response patterns. This client also gives you access to Foundry direct models (non-Azure-OpenAI models hosted in Foundry). The project endpoint serves this traffic on the
/openairoute.
Most apps use both clients. Use the project client for setup and configuration, then use the OpenAI-compatible client for running agents, evaluations, and calling models (including Foundry direct models).
Create a project client:
from azure.identity import DefaultAzureCredential
from azure.ai.projects import AIProjectClient
project = AIProjectClient(
endpoint="https://<resource-name>.services.ai.azure.com/api/projects/<project-name>",
credential=DefaultAzureCredential())
Create an OpenAI-compatible client from your project:
openai_client = project.inference.get_azure_openai_client(api_version="2024-10-21")
response = openai_client.responses.create(
model="gpt-5.2",
input="What is the speed of light?",
)
print(response.output_text)

OpenAI SDK
Use the OpenAI SDK when you want the full OpenAI API surface and maximum client compatibility. This endpoint provides access to Azure OpenAI models and Foundry direct models (via Chat Completions API). It does not provide access to Foundry-specific features like agents and evaluations.
Create an OpenAI client from your project
This snippet uses the AIProjectClient to request an OpenAI client scoped to your project.
# Use the AIProjectClient to create an OpenAI client for your project
openai_client = project.get_openai_client(api_version="2024-10-21")
response = openai_client.responses.create(
model="gpt-5.2",
input="What is the size of France in square miles?",
)
print(f"Response output: {response.output_text}")
The following snippet shows how to use the Azure OpenAI /openai/v1 endpoint directly.
from openai import OpenAI
from azure.identity import DefaultAzureCredential, get_bearer_token_provider
token_provider = get_bearer_token_provider(
DefaultAzureCredential(), "https://cognitiveservices.azure.com/.default"
)
client = OpenAI(
base_url = "https://<resource-name>.openai.azure.com/openai/v1/",
api_key=token_provider,
)
response = client.responses.create(
model="model_deployment_name",
input= "What is the size of France in square miles?"
)
print(response.model_dump_json(indent=2))
For more information, see Azure OpenAI supported programming languages.

Using the Agent Framework for local orchestration
Microsoft Agent Framework is an open-source SDK for building multi-agent systems in code (for example, .NET and Python) with a cloud-provider-agnostic interface.
Use Agent Framework when you want to define and orchestrate agents locally. Pair it with the Foundry SDK when you want those agents to run against Foundry models or when you want Agent Framework to orchestrate agents hosted in Foundry.

Foundry Tools SDKs
Foundry Tools (formerly Azure AI Services) are prebuilt point solutions with dedicated SDKs. Use the following endpoints to work with Foundry Tools.
Which endpoint should you use?
Choose an endpoint based on your needs:
Use the Azure AI Services endpoint to access Computer Vision, Content Safety, Document Intelligence, Language, Translation, and Token Foundry Tools.
Foundry Tools endpoint: https://<your-resource-name>.cognitiveservices.azure.com/
Note
Endpoints use either your resource name or a custom subdomain. If your organization set up a custom subdomain, replace your-resource-name with your-custom-subdomain in all endpoint examples.
For Speech and Translation Foundry Tools, use the endpoints in the following tables. Replace placeholders with your resource information.
Speech Endpoints
| Foundry Tool | Endpoint |
|---|---|
| Speech to Text (Standard) | https://<YOUR-RESOURCE-REGION>.stt.speech.microsoft.com |
| Text to Speech (Neural) | https://<YOUR-RESOURCE-REGION>.tts.speech.microsoft.com |
| Custom Voice | https://<YOUR-RESOURCE-NAME>.cognitiveservices.azure.com/ |
Translation Endpoints
| Foundry Tool | Endpoint |
|---|---|
| Text Translation | https://api.cognitive.microsofttranslator.com/ |
| Document Translation | https://<YOUR-RESOURCE-NAME>.cognitiveservices.azure.com/ |
